Profile

Vice President, Intellectual Property The candidate will lead the Company’s intellectual property group and will advise and interact with senior management, scientists and other company personnel autonomously. Demonstrated the ability to effectively devise and implement the patent and IP strategy for a high growth, global biotech company with deep knowledge regarding the filing and prosecution of patents and other intellectual property for strong product exclusivity and advise on license and M&A transactions, adversarial proceedings, partnership management to the extent involving intellectual property required. Provide practical legal intellectual property advice that furthers business strategies/objectives and executes the IP Strategy. Ability to advise and communicate with senior management and the board of directors as needed. Provide leadership and mentoring to the IP team. Develop and manage the Company’s extensive portfolios relating to products in both the chemical and biological sciences and providing a strategic framework for protecting new inventions, including FTO analysis. Manage all aspects of patent prosecution including preparing and/or assisting in filing applications and office actions in all jurisdictions and conducting or overseeing interviews with inventors in this regard. Assist in intellectual property due diligence in potential mergers and acquisitions and other strategic initiatives that involve intellectual property as well as supervising outside counsel in a cost effective manner for same. Successfully work with transactional lawyers on the drafting, negotiating, and managing of license agreements, joint development agreements and other complex intellectual property agreements and/or transactions. Provide assistance on patent, trademark, copyright, domain name and other intellectual property matters. Assist in working with in-house and outside counsel with intellectual property litigation and disputes in a cost effective manner, including potential generic or biosimilar challenges. Review and resolve claims or potential claims of both offensive and defensive IP infringement. Juris Doctorate from nationally recognized law school; admission to practice in the United States Patent and Trademark Office; US state bar admission in good standing; advanced degree in chemistry or biological sciences highly preferred. 15+ years in patent prosecution with experience in biotech or pharma as head of intellectual property or deputy head of intellectual property required. Experience managing lawyers and staff and counseling senior business leaders required.
